One WWE star might be running wild on Monday Night Raw, but when it comes to singles matches, they just can’t catch a win.

Since Paul Heyman screwed CM Punk and Roman Reigns in the main event of WrestleMania 41, he and Seth Rollins have sought to dominate Monday Night Raw together. Very quickly, the pair had more backup as Bron Breakker joined their ranks before Bronson Reed rounded out the group, despite his own previous serious issues with Rollins.

Reed, Breakker, and Heyman might have to go their own way for the foreseeable future after Seth Rollins suffered an apparent serious knee injury during a recent bout that could put him on the shelf for quite some time.

And Bronson Reed will hope to have picked up a singles win before Rollins comes back.

Bronson Reed Loses Again In WWE

The last time Reed won a singles match was, ironically, against Seth Rollins on the 11th of November 2024 edition of Raw. A serious injury suffered in WarGames at 2024’s Survivor Series put Reed on the shelf for several months, and now his losing streak in singles action has stretched to 245 days as he lost in a live event bout on the 19th of July to LA Knight.

The only win Reed has picked up in all that time came when he teamed with Bron Breakker on the June 30th edition of WWE Raw, when they defeated Penta and Sami Zayn.
